diff --git a/springdoc-openapi-starter-common/src/main/java/org/springdoc/core/service/GenericResponseService.java b/springdoc-openapi-starter-common/src/main/java/org/springdoc/core/service/GenericResponseService.java index f26f4a90b..8d3e8e715 100644 --- a/springdoc-openapi-starter-common/src/main/java/org/springdoc/core/service/GenericResponseService.java +++ b/springdoc-openapi-starter-common/src/main/java/org/springdoc/core/service/GenericResponseService.java @@ -705,7 +705,7 @@ private Map getGenericMapResponse(HandlerMethod handlerMeth List controllerAdviceInfosNotInThisBean = controllerAdviceInfos.stream() .filter(controllerAdviceInfo -> - getControllerAdviceBean(controllerAdviceBeans, controllerAdviceInfo.getControllerAdvice()) + getControllerAdviceBean(controllerAdviceBeans, controllerAdviceInfo.getControllerAdvice().toString()) .isApplicableToBeanType(beanType)) .filter(controllerAdviceInfo -> !beanType.equals(controllerAdviceInfo.getControllerAdvice().getClass())) .toList();